The internet is loaded with all sorts of memes trying to serve as marriage tests. Spend long enough on the car-related area of the world wide web and you'll definitely come across one of these memes telling you to keep your SO forever if she shares the bathtub with those new wheels, just to keep them squeaky clean.
While this might seem a piece of amusement and nothing more, some girlfriends take things literally. We've just come across such an example and wanted to share the story, one that involves a Miata, with you.

As many other NA (this is the first generation) Miata owners, Redditor idownvotethenread, who brought us this story, has installed a number of mods on his Mazda.

The same goes for the various battle scars any tracked Miata gets after reaching a certain age. You know, the little stuff, such as a rock chip here and there. The man's MX-5, a 1996 model, couldn't have missed these.

When the guy received a Hotwheels version of his four-wheeled pride and joy from his girlfriend, he was swiped off his feet when he noticed the resemblance between the actual car and the toy version.

Now, the NA Miata is a standard Hotwheels car, so you can buy one off the shelf. However, the owner's SO paid close attention to the specific details of the MX-5 in question, mirroring these on the toy.

To be more specific, we're talking about the missing paint on the front apron, the blacked-out side of the rear end, as well as the green gear shifter.

Well, when your SO comes up with such a surprise, things get a bit more serious. And given all the compromises a Miata girlfriend has to make during her life inside the car, the bonus points for her just keep adding up.
